Website Design Trends 2024: How to make your site stand out
In the world of web design, innovation never stops.
2024 brings with it new trends that can radically transform the look and functionality of your website.
Here are some of the most promising trends you can leverage to make your site stand out.
1. Minimalism and Simplicity
Minimalism remains a key trend. In 2024, we see an even more refined approach: clean layouts, fewer distracting elements, and a greater emphasis on content. This not only improves user experience, but is also great for SEO, as faster and cleaner sites are favored by search engines.
2. Bold Colors and Innovative Color Scheme
Colors play a crucial role in capturing user attention. In 2024, websites are sporting bolder, more vibrant color schemes, often with neon or pastel hues. Such color schemes not only make the site memorable but also help communicate the brand's identity.
3. Creative and Diversified Typography
Typography is no longer just a means of conveying information; it has become an art form. Big, bold fonts, and unique typography styles can make a big difference in setting your site apart from the crowd.
4. Interactivity and Animations
Interactive elements and subtle animations can greatly enrich the visitor experience. In 2024, we see more strategic use of these features, which serve to guide the user through the site journey in a smooth and engaging way.
5. Accessibility and Inclusivity
An increasingly important aspect of web design is accessibility. Make sure your site is navigable and usable by all users, including those with disabilities. Not only is this an ethical imperative, but it also improves your reach and regulatory compliance.
